    Creating a Longstanding Food Pantry Lead by Students of Color

    Get PDF
    This poster presentation examines the ongoing efforts of PUSH, (President\u27s United to Solve Hunger) an international initiative across university campuses that focuses on alleviating hunger on campus. The Central Washington chapter differs from other university campuses as it is student-led and student-initiated. Through examining PUSH’s food justice initiatives such as the Wildcat Pantry, we can determine how our efforts have impacted the CWU community at large. With the new establishment of the Wildcat Pantry, a free food and supply resource, our team has faced several challenges such as consistent staffing, inventory maintenance, and social awareness

    Super Bowl Popularity Estimated Using Taylor, Legrange, Hermite, and Cubic Spline Approximations

    No full text
    The Super Bowl is the annual playoff championship game for American Football of the National Football League, or NFL. The Super Bowl has served as the last game in every NFL season since 1966. Viewership and ratings have been recorded for each Super Bowl since the Super Bowl II in 1967. Taking viewership to represent the popularity of the event, we create high-order polynomials using various methods to further understand Super Bowl popularity. Taylor\u27s theorem is used alongside Lagrange polynomials, Hermite polynomials, and cubic splines to predict popularity of the Super Bowl between when the event is annually held. Additionally, numerical differentiation methods are used to further understand how the rate of change of the popularity of the Super Bowl changes over time. This is done in part to understand how streaming and the COVID-19 pandemic has potentially affected viewership

    Late Holocene Fire History Reconstruction from Beaver Lake in the Northwest Lowlands of The Olympic Peninsula

    Get PDF
    Fire is an important component of the landscapes and forests of the PNW, including the temperate rainforests of the Olympic Peninsula in northwest corner of Washington State. Previous studies in other areas of the peninsula show that past fire activity has varied locally and regionally as a result of changes in vegetation, climate, and human-land use activities since the early Holocene. The reconstruction of a late Holocene fire history record from the Beaver Lake watershed will provide a high resolution record in the currently understudied northwest section of the peninsula. This study uses macroscopic charcoal analysis of a 6.17 meter-long lake sediment core to illustrate how fire activity has varied at the site during the past 3400 years. The results of this study will be compared to local and regional records of changing vegetation, climate, and human-land use activities to provide a more complete understanding of the environmental history of the Olympic Peninsula during the late Holocene. Preliminary results show that fire has been present at Beaver Lake for at least the past 500 years in varying amounts, and continued research on the sediment core aims to pinpoint more specific shifts in fire activity. Land managers, archaeologists, and other researchers can use this data to better understand human-environment interactions in the case of fire on the peninsula

    Composition of Creek Sediment Through Farmland - Kittitas County

    No full text
    We measured the elemental composition of sediment at the heads compared to the mouths of six different streams in Kittitas County, Washington. Sediment composition can determine the effects of large-scale agricultural fertilization and the health of stream ecosystems as they flow through farmland. We collected two sediment samples from each of the six creeks we selected in Kittitas County, and determined the elemental composition of the samples. We analyzed the samples using Central Washington University’s ICP-OES which provided results in which most streams had high amounts of specific elements, including: aluminum, calcium, iron, and potassium. Our measurements showed the opposite of our hypothesis; streams contain higher concentrations of elements at the tops of creeks versus the bottoms, with a few exceptions that may have resulted from errors in the procedure. Further research could be conducted to determine why higher concentrations of elements are found at the tops of creeks, and whether this is the case in other counties as well

    Lexical data analysis of popular hiking areas in the Alpine Lakes Wilderness

    No full text
    During the COVID19 pandemic public lands felt a massive surge in visitation with people looking for alternative socially-distanced activities. As land managers scrambled to keep up with maintaining these spaces, there was a demand for more efficient ways of understanding problems and making decisions. One solution to this problem is the implementation of spatial data analytics, which can help prioritize department resources to areas of concern. Lexical data provided by recreationalists can efficiently provide valuable information about visitation through use of data analytics software.To demonstrate the value of spatial data analytics in land management, I will be working with lexical survey data from the most well-traveled hiking areas of Alpine Lakes Wilderness. I will identify key words and shared themes of both positive and negative sentiment. By integrating the data with geographical locations I will show areas and features needing special attention

    King Sejong\u27s Legacy

    No full text
    King Sejong (1397-1450) is known as one of the greatest rulers of Korea of all time, as he created Hangul (Korean alphabet), encouraged significant scientific advancements, reinforced Confucianism in Korea, and caused many political and social advancements. However, despite how important he is in Korean culture, he is rarely mentioned in American classes about Asia. This knowledge is more important now than ever, with South Korea being a major power in economics, technology, and more. To rectify the lack of knowledge of King Sejong, this presentation will cover his achievements and their influence on Korea today, the most obvious of which being Hangul, which is the current Korean writing system. The presentation will also cover how his Confucian beliefs influenced his achievements, as King Sejong’s reign was a major turning point for Korea in terms of Confucian impact. A major reason why there is so much information about King Sejong, even though he lived in the early 1400s relates to another of his accomplishments – he took the printing advancements that had been made during his father’s reign and embraced them, causing Korea to become the lead East Asian nation in printing, improving printing speeds by 20 times before the design was finalized, providing a better way of publishing scientific advancements and inventions. Through these publications and modern publications discussing them, we can get a picture of King Sejong’s life and influence. The broad scope of his influence will illustrate the Korean trajectory of innovation and accomplishment that we see today

    Interpretable Machine Learning for Self-Service High-Risk Decision-Making

    No full text
    This presentation contributes to interpretable machine learning via visual knowledge discovery in general line coordinates (GLC). The concepts of hyperblocks as interpretable dataset units and general line coordinates are combined to create a visual self-service machine learning model. The DSC1 and DSC2 lossless multidimensional coordinate systems are proposed. DSC1 and DSC2 can map multiple dataset attributes to a single two-dimensional (X, Y) Cartesian plane using a graph construction algorithm. The hyperblock analysis was used to determine visually appealing dataset attribute orders and to reduce line occlusion. It is shown that hyperblocks can generalize decision tree rules and a series of DSC1 or DSC2 plots can visualize a decision tree. The DSC1 and DSC2 plots were tested on benchmark datasets from the UCI ML repository. They allowed for visual classification of data. Additionally, areas of hyperblock impurity were discovered and used to establish dataset splits that highlight the upper estimate of worst-case model accuracy to guide model selection for high-risk decision-making. Major benefits of DSC1 and DSC2 is their highly interpretable nature. They allow domain experts to control or establish new machine learning models through visual pattern discovery
